richie imasuen

  1. Iroka Chinedu

    Metro I slept among corpses in Libya — Nigerian returnee - vanguard Ng

    Imasuen Richie was one of the youngmen who left Nigeria for Libya in 2016 with a view to finally land in Europe in search of greener pastures. But sadly, he found himself inside the Libyan prison after he was sold as a slave. It was in that situation that he met CNN crew who came into the...